The Shanghai IFC ranks among the largest commercial developments in the Pudong Lujiazui District and serves as a new landmark for the area. The development consists of 4 million square feet (370,000 square meters) of gross floor area, two grade-A office towers, the international Shanghai IFC Mall, deluxe IFC Residence suite hotel, and the Ritz-Carlton Shanghai.
The project features two mixed-use towers. Tower One is an 853-foot- (260-meter-) tall, 45-story office tower providing 1.3 million square feet (122,000 square meters) of state-of-the-art intelligent office accommodations. The adjacent tower measuring 820 feet (250 meters) houses the HSBC Headquarters on its first 30 floors and the 260-room Ritz Carlton Hotel on the top 15 floors. The 1-million-square-foot (100,000-square-meter) IFC Mall connects the two towers offering top brand name shopping as well as some of the city’s most popular restaurants.
WSP served as the mechanical, electrical, plumbing and drainage consultant. The project received the Highest Business Value Gold and Best Commercial Landmark awards at the second CBN Property Reporter Real Estate Awards in 2011.
